Each team was able to score a touchdown and Georgia Tech took a 21-14 lead into the fourth quarter.

TaQuon Marshall led the Yellow Jackets on an 11-play, 80-yard drive and scored on a 1-yard touchdown run, his second of the game.

After a missed Georgia Tech field goal, Tennessee quarterback Quinten Dormady led the Volunteers on a scoring drive, capped of with a 10-yard touchdown pass to Marquez Callaway.
